
Family Service Association of Bucks County – Street Medicine
Their Family Street Medicine Program is open to all of the unsheltered people of Bucks County. They provide general medical/mental health wellness checks, basic first aid and medical procedures, vaccines and preventative medicine, case management, medical referrals, coordination of appointments and transportation to urgent or specialized care facilities when necessary, educational clinics and seminars about upholding medical and mental wellness through self-care, and provision of ‘basic needs’ items (including food, water, blankets, personal hygiene items, etc.).
